July 14, 200916 yr comment_5441954 Phil made me watch three of the matches from this Boston Garden show to temper his enthusiasm. I liked all three but am not sure what to do with any of them. I dug both this and the Funk v Morales match. Both really satisfying. Both had really similar heels in role of guy who stooge get pantsed and bump around for the faces. Bruno brought more to the table as face than Morales. What may distinguish this type of formula match in the end is how much the faces bring. But on some level the one man Funk show is the more fun stooging bumping heel show. This also had the chairs and plunder. Still there was a certain sameness to watching two of these matches in a row. A whole set of WWF formula heels fly around, get pantsed and stooge for WWF faces is going to be a mess of indistinguishable matches.
